Fengate Capital promotes Pranav Pandya to Chief Financial Officer

Fengate has announced the promotion of Pranav Pandya to Chief Financial Officer, effective immediately.

Mr. Pandya will assume responsibility for global finance and accounting, and will provide oversight, leadership and direction for investor relations, corporate development and strategic planning.

Founded in 1974, Fengate began as a real estate business in Ontario, Canada. Since then, it have become one of Canada’s leading real asset investment firms, with a diverse portfolio of real estate, infrastructure and private equity assets in North America, the United Kingdom and Australia.

President and CEO Lou Serafini said:

“I am delighted to announce Pranav’s well-deserved promotion to CFO. Pranav has been an instrumental member of Fengate’s finance and accounting team and has developed and expanded his role during his nine years with Fengate. He has played an integral role in our success. With Pranav’s intimate understanding of the business and its stakeholders and his immense capabilities we know that he will continue to add tremendous value to Fengate.”
